Architecture of Observation Towers

It seems to be human nature to enjoy a view, getting the higher ground and taking in our surroundings has become a significant aspect of architecture across the world. Observation towers which allow visitors to climb and observe their surroundings, provide a chance to take in the beauty of the land while at the same time adding something unique and impressive to the landscape.

Model Making In Architecture

The importance of model making in architecture could be thought to have reduced in recent years. With the introduction of new and innovative architecture design technology, is there still a place for model making in architecture? Stanton Williams, director at Stirling Prize-winning practice, Gavin Henderson, believes that it’s more important than ever.

Asbestos litigation is governed by a wide range of laws and rules that vary by state. They can cover minimum medical criteria two-disease regulations, fast case scheduling and joinders among others. New York is among the states which have passed asbestos legislation. For instance, the James L. Zadroga 9/11 Health & Compensation Act helped first responders who suffered from health issues as a result of their work at the World Trade Center following the attacks.

Asbestos is a fibrous rock that is used for its flexibility, strength and resistance to chemicals and heat. It was widely employed in commercial and industrial applications throughout the 20th century, including insulation for pipes and fireproofing materials, as well as cements and plasters, and brakes for cars. However, exposure to asbestos can result in serious injuries and illnesses including mesothelioma and various forms of lung cancer. The discovery process is a key component of your settlement negotiations. During this process your attorney will ask documents from the defendants in your case. They will also conduct depositions that are sworn declarations that can be used in your trial. Your lawyer will prepare the deposition ahead of time and will be with you throughout the process.
